Five stars - great This was my first time going to a Korean BBQ. We went in blind, so we had no clue what to do, what to order, etc. Our waitress was very friendly. She didn't do the best job of explaining how the menu worked (there was a little language barrier), but we ultimately figured it out. I'll do my best to explain how things work. Essentially, you can order a variety of meats and appetizers, which are separated into three categories. If you purchase the higher tier, you not only have access to the meats/appetizers of that tier, but also any tier below it. You get unlimited food for two hours. During that time, you can cook and eat a variety of meats that are available in your selected tier. You could order three dishes and three sides at a time. Despite not knowing how things worked, we had a great experience. We got the first tier ($35 per person), and we were satisfied with our options, but we will definitely get a higher tier next time we go. We got three rounds of food, and we were stuffed. It was really fun cooking the meats while we enjoyed our appetizers and drinks. This is the perfect restaurant for catching up with friends and family because you will be there a while. I would recommend going with an empty stomach. We will certainly be going back!

Key takeaways: not worth the cost, portion sizes are not uniform, limited to 6 dishes every 7 minutes. Went to this restaurant for the first time about a week and a half ago. It was my wife and I with 2 friends. There was no wait to be served. They had plenty of tables open, but decided to sit us next to another group, and the booth side of the table only has one way to get in and out due to how they plumbed the gas lines. The waitress introduced herself and we let her knkw it was our first time there. She explained the menu and stated that they have a limit of 6 items max per order, and that we could reorder after 7 minutes. She stated the servings were good sized, so we ordered the premium. We got some rice, wagyu steak bites and beef strips. When the dishes came out it was surprising to us how small they were, considering there was 4 of us sharing the 6 items. The fried rice was good but was not big enough for 4. The steak bites weren't worth the premium cost, never had wagyu beef that was bristle and so fatty. The portion gave each of us 2 small pieces each. We ordered other items over the course of our dinner. About the 4th order we ordered another fried rice and some corn cheese. The corn cheese came out in a mini cast iron skillet which would have been good for one person, not 4. It was good. The second order of fried rice was twice the size of the first, and we only order 1 of it. We asked the waitress why the sizes seemed to be getting bigger the longer we stayed and kept ordering. She couldn't answer that question. That serving of fried rice made us watch the sizes of other dishes. In general, the sizes of the dishes were slowly getting larger the longer we ate. The only thing that makes sense with this business practice is they have on their menu any leftovers would be charged $25 per plate. So, they increase the chances of being able to do that by starting with small dishes that make you order more when the 7 minutes were up. As you get to the end of the meal, if you aren't careful, the serving sizes are so much, that you could easily fall into the trap they have laid. Oh, and you cant take the food you have to pay extra for home, no takeout. Ordering food was done via a table touchscreen which was not easy to navigate. Our waitress wasnt really paying much attention to things, especially when we wanted our check.
